Michael Brini Ferri (born 18 July 1989) is an Italian footballer who plays for Viareggio.

Contents

Biography

Born in Ferrara, Emilia–Romagna, Brini Ferri started his career at Sassuolo. In 2009, he left for Viareggio in co-ownership deal along with Andrea Briotti. In June 2010 Sassuolo gave up the remain 50% registration rights to Viareggio. After no appearance in the first half of 2010–11 Lega Pro Prima Divisione, Brini Ferri joined Serie D (non-professional/regional) team Camaiore on free transfer. [1] On 23 June he returned to Viareggio. [2]
